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Casablanca - Rabat

    Start your day at Hassan II Mosque, one of the world's largest religious structures, then take a walk along Casablanca's Corniche for ocean views. From there you'll head to Rabat where you can see the UNESCO-listed Oudaias Kasbah and Hassan Tower. After that, check out the Mausoleum of Mohammed V before wandering through the medina and past the royal palace. You'll return to your hotel by evening after a full day of sightseeing.

  2. Day 2

    Rabat - Meknes - Volubilis - Fes

    Leave Rabat heading toward Meknes to see Bab Mansour and the Mausoleum of Moulay Ismail. Later you'll drive to Volubilis, a UNESCO World Heritage Site where you can walk through ancient Roman ruins and look at intricate mosaics. From there continue on to Fes, settle into your accommodation, and have a traditional Moroccan dinner at a local restaurant.

  3. Day 3

    Fes

    Spend the entire day in Fez, the oldest imperial city and religious capital of Morocco. Walk through the medieval medina, visit Bou Anania and Attarine Medersas, and see the entrance to the Qarawiyyin Mosque, one of the oldest universities in the world. Stop by the Nejjarine fountain and spend time wandering the souks. Head back to your riad for dinner and an overnight stay.

  4. Day 4

    Fes - Ifrane - Midelt - Ziz Valley - Merzouga

    Depart Fes and travel through Ifrane, known as 'Little Switzerland' because of its alpine architecture and forests. Then pass through Midelt in the Atlas Mountains where you'll see dramatic mountain views. Later you'll go through the Ziz Valley with its palm groves and canyon landscapes before arriving in Merzouga. End the day with a camel trek into the Sahara Desert, watching the sunset, and sleeping at a desert camp under the night sky.

  5. Day 5

    Erg Chebbi - Erfoud - Todra Gorges - Dades Gorges

    Leave Erg Chebbi and travel toward Todra Gorges, passing through Erfoud along the way. Explore the towering Todra Gorges where the canyon walls rise dramatically around you. After that, head to Dades Gorges where the landscape is rugged and varied. You'll stay overnight in a traditional guesthouse in the area.

  6. Day 6

    Dades Gorges - Valley of Roses - Ait Ben Haddou - Marrakech

    Leave Dades Gorges and travel through the Valley of Roses, then continue to Ait Ben Haddou,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its distinctive adobe architecture and layout. From there journey to Marrakech, which brings your adventure to an end.
